Output 566696f46ae8e618b911a125bc69aa312d8bec6bf4f0c3c811461b88e2a0e4a3:11

value
22386203
script pubkey
OP_0 OP_PUSHBYTES_20 34bb0da38c4662563e44a24cb0615c8a6e78b205
address
ltc1qxjasmguvge39v0jy5fxtqc2u3fh83vs9lvr0xd
transaction
566696f46ae8e618b911a125bc69aa312d8bec6bf4f0c3c811461b88e2a0e4a3
spent
true